Redundancia de datos reducida :
- La normalización elimina datos duplicados organizándolos en múltiples tablas basadas en relaciones lógicas. Esto reduce la redundancia de datos, lo que simplifica la redacción de consultas, ya que solo necesita consultar las tablas relevantes sin preocuparse por la información duplicada.
Integridad de datos mejorada :
- Las tablas normalizadas aseguran la integridad referencial, manteniendo la coherencia entre los datos relacionados. Esto le permite escribir consultas con mayor confianza, sabiendo que los datos recuperados serán precisos y consistentes. No necesita preocuparse por las anomalías o inconsistencias de los datos que pueden ocurrir en bases de datos no normalizadas.
Operaciones de unión optimizadas :
- La normalización adecuada a menudo implica el uso de claves primarias y claves externas para establecer relaciones entre tablas. Estas claves ayudan a realizar operaciones de unión optimizadas al consultar datos. Al utilizar condiciones de unión adecuadas, puede recuperar datos de forma eficaz de varias tablas en función de sus relaciones.
Estructura de consulta simplificada :
- Las tablas normalizadas dan como resultado un esquema de base de datos más lógico y estructurado. Esta simplificación se traduce en escribir consultas más simples y directas. Puede comprender y navegar fácilmente por las relaciones entre tablas y especificar los datos deseados sin subconsultas complejas ni múltiples uniones.
Ejecución de consultas más rápida :
- La normalización puede conducir a tiempos de ejecución de consultas más rápidos. Al eliminar datos redundantes y optimizar las estructuras de las tablas, la base de datos puede acceder y recuperar datos de manera más eficiente. La ejecución eficiente de consultas es especialmente importante para grandes conjuntos de datos y consultas complejas.
Escalabilidad de datos mejorada :
- Las bases de datos normalizadas son más escalables cuando manejan cantidades cada vez mayores de datos. A medida que la base de datos crece, las tablas correctamente normalizadas pueden acomodar nuevos datos sin comprometer el rendimiento de las consultas. Esto facilita el mantenimiento de la base de datos y garantiza una ejecución eficiente de las consultas incluso con un crecimiento significativo de los datos.
Seguridad de datos mejorada :
- La normalización ayuda a implementar medidas de seguridad de datos de manera efectiva. Al separar los datos confidenciales en tablas separadas, puede controlar el acceso y los permisos de manera más granular. Esto ayuda a proteger la información confidencial y garantiza el cumplimiento de las normas de privacidad de datos.
En resumen, la normalización desempeña un papel crucial a la hora de simplificar la redacción de consultas, mejorar la integridad de los datos, optimizar el rendimiento de las consultas y mejorar la eficiencia y el mantenimiento general de la base de datos. Siguiendo principios sólidos de normalización, los diseñadores y desarrolladores de bases de datos pueden crear esquemas que faciliten la recuperación y gestión eficiente de datos, lo que lleva a un mejor rendimiento de las aplicaciones y a la satisfacción del usuario.